Štěpánovská hora lies in the municipalities of Lukov and Hrobčice and rises directly above Štěpánov. It is a protected natural monument in the České středohoří Protected Landscape Area, is among the highest-elevation steppe clearings in České středohoří, reaches an elevation of up to 608 m, and is home to numerous significant plant species.

Culture and History
A fortress in Lukov is first mentioned in 1496. The archaeological site “historické jádro obce Lukov” lies above the source of an unnamed tributary of the Lukovský potok. At the same time, the urban structure and arrangement of buildings in Lukov are largely authentic.
The ruins of Sukoslav and the ruins of Hradek Oltářík are located in the vicinity of Lukov. The Hrádek ruins are situated around Lukov, while Hrad Střekov Castle lies in the wider regional surroundings of Lukov.
